当前位置:首页 > 数据库课程设计2 - 学分管理系统 - 图文
数据库课程设计
课程名:学分管理系统
姓名:XXX
专业班级:XXXX
年级:XXXX
指导老师:XXXX
设计时间:XXXXX
一.课设题目:学分管理系统
1.使用的开发工具:visual studio2010系统, sql server2005 ,windows xp sp3操作系统. 2.开发语言:C#面向对象语言 二.系统开发步骤:
1.系统功能设计(软件结构设计)
步骤:(1)系统总体功能模块图设计
系统总控模块 编辑数据 查询数据 统计数据 系统维护 退出 添加,删除 学生 信息 添加 课程信息 编辑学生分数 按课程号查 按班级号查 查不及格名单 查应留级名单 按姓名查(按姓名) 按班级统计不及格人数及比例 按班级统计各分数段人数及比例 各科的平均分数 密码的设置与修改 数据库数据转储 代码库的维护 帮助 (2)系统详细功能设计
将总体功能模块图中的每个模块进行逻辑过程的设计。
a.系统封面设计:画出封面的显示图
b.系统总控模块设计(菜单):画出菜单的显示图 2.数据库结构的设计 a.数据库表格:
Student(Sno,Sclass,Ssex,Sdept,Sname,Spsw), Course(Cno,Cname), SC(Sno, Cno,Grade), denglu(us_id,us_name,us_psw), b. ER图:
姓名 性别 班级 专业 学号 学生 登录密码 选课 课程编号 课程 课程名称 登陆名 管理员 编号 登录密 码
3.系统的功能实现界面
1>登录界面:(用户角色:学生和管理员) 学生登录界面:
管理员登录界面:
2>学生模块:(查询个人的课程信息,个人信息,
查询各科的成绩,修改登录密码,退出系统)
共分享92篇相关文档